Where Kiwi Treasure’s privacy approach begins
At Kiwi Treasure, we are committed to handling personal data in a way that is measured, transparent, and suited to the services we provide. This Privacy Policy applies to information connected with the use of Kiwi Treasure websites, accounts, communications, and related services where personal data is collected, stored, reviewed, or otherwise handled.
The type of information involved can vary depending on how Kiwi Treasure is used. Some data is provided directly by the user. Other information is created through account activity, technical interaction, verification checks, communications, payment-related actions, or internal review processes linked to security and compliance.
By creating an account, accessing Kiwi Treasure, or contacting us through our services, you acknowledge that personal data may be handled in line with this Privacy Policy and with any applicable requirements relevant to the location and service involved.
Personal details Kiwi Treasure may collect and receive
We may collect personal data that a user provides during registration, account updates, identity checks, support enquiries, payment-related activity, promotional participation where relevant, or other direct interaction with Kiwi Treasure. Depending on the situation, this may include name, date of birth, residential information, email address, telephone number, account credentials, transaction-related details, and documents used to confirm identity or ownership.
Kiwi Treasure may also receive information generated through the use of the service. This can include login history, IP address, browser type, operating system, device information, language settings, gameplay activity, betting records, transaction logs, timestamps, site interaction data, and communication history. Where relevant, this may also include information connected with responsible gambling controls, account restrictions, fraud checks, or dispute review.
Some information may also come from third parties where that is necessary for account operation, verification, payment handling, risk assessment, analytics, communication delivery, or technical support. The scope of that information may depend on the services used and the way the account is being accessed.
Why Kiwi Treasure uses personal data in day-to-day operation
We use personal data to operate Kiwi Treasure and to maintain the service relationship with the user. That includes creating and managing accounts, confirming access, processing payments and withdrawals, keeping records, responding to enquiries, and sending service-related communications where appropriate.
Personal data may also be used for identity verification, fraud prevention, transaction monitoring, safer gambling measures, dispute handling, technical support, internal reporting, service improvement, and compliance with legal or regulatory obligations where required. Some processing is necessary to protect the integrity of the service and to reduce misuse of the platform.
Where permitted or required, Kiwi Treasure may also use certain information to send promotional or informational messages connected with the service. Users may be able to manage communication preferences through account settings, message controls, or other available routes, depending on the type of communication involved.
How Kiwi Treasure handles checks linked to verification and compliance
Some personal data is processed because access to Kiwi Treasure and related services may require review beyond standard registration details. We may examine information to confirm identity, assess account ownership, review transaction consistency, respond to unusual activity, or support obligations connected with fraud prevention, safer gambling, and compliance.
Where additional information is needed, we may request supporting records or documents before certain account functions continue. The type of material requested may depend on the account activity involved, the transaction under review, or the nature of the issue being assessed. Until such checks are completed, some parts of the service may be limited where necessary.
We may keep records connected with these reviews for compliance, account security, internal control, dispute handling, and lawful operation of Kiwi Treasure. Review processes may involve automated checks, manual assessment, or both, depending on the situation.
When Kiwi Treasure may disclose or transfer information
Kiwi Treasure may disclose personal data where this is necessary to operate the service, support account use, or meet legal and compliance obligations. Depending on the context, this may include payment providers, identity verification partners, fraud prevention services, technical infrastructure providers, analytics tools, communication systems, professional advisers, or related business entities involved in service support.
Information may also be disclosed where required by applicable law, where a valid request is received from a regulator, court, public authority, or enforcement body, or where disclosure is reasonably necessary in connection with legal claims, investigations, or protection of our rights and operations.
Because services may rely on infrastructure or support arrangements across different locations, personal data may in some cases be accessed, processed, or stored outside the country from which a user connects. Where that occurs, Kiwi Treasure takes steps appropriate to the circumstances of the transfer and the nature of the receiving party.
Cookies, technical records, and Kiwi Treasure website activity
Kiwi Treasure may use cookies and similar technologies to support website functionality, maintain sessions, remember preferences, recognise returning devices, measure usage patterns, and improve the way the service performs. Some of these tools are tied to core website operation, while others may support analytics, communication performance, or technical review.
Technical records may also be collected automatically when a user accesses Kiwi Treasure. These records can include browser details, device identifiers, network information, page interactions, referral data, timestamps, and error logs. We use this information to support system administration, website performance, account protection, abuse prevention, and service improvement.
Depending on the device and browser in use, users may be able to adjust some cookie or tracking settings directly. Restricting certain cookies or related technologies may affect how some parts of the Kiwi Treasure website function.
The way Kiwi Treasure protects data and keeps records
We take appropriate steps to protect personal data against unauthorised access, misuse, loss, alteration, and improper disclosure. These steps may include access controls, authentication measures, monitoring processes, internal procedures, vendor oversight, and technical safeguards suited to the information being handled.
No online service can be guaranteed to be entirely free from risk. Users should also take reasonable steps to protect their own information by keeping account details confidential, avoiding shared access, and notifying Kiwi Treasure if unauthorised use or compromise is suspected.
We may retain information for as long as reasonably necessary for account administration, transaction history, compliance review, fraud prevention, safer gambling measures, dispute handling, security monitoring, and operational continuity. Specific retention periods may depend on legal, regulatory, and operational requirements as well as the nature of the data involved.
Privacy rights and choices connected with Kiwi Treasure
Where applicable, users in New Zealand may have rights or choices in relation to personal data held by Kiwi Treasure. Depending on the circumstances, this may include requesting access to personal information, asking for corrections, objecting to certain uses, requesting deletion in limited situations, or managing direct marketing preferences.
These rights are not absolute. In some situations, Kiwi Treasure may need to continue holding or using certain information to comply with legal obligations, maintain accurate records, investigate misuse, resolve disputes, verify identity, or protect the service. Before acting on a privacy request, we may require information needed to confirm the identity of the person making that request.
Some personal details may also be managed directly through account settings where those options are available. Preference choices for communications may likewise be adjusted through message controls or other available service routes.
